路由協(xié)議基礎(chǔ)
路由算法
1.靜態(tài)路由算法(非自適應(yīng)路由算法)
? 管理員手工配置路由信息,簡單、可靠,在負荷穩(wěn)定、拓撲變化不大的網(wǎng)絡(luò)中運行效果很好,廣泛用于高度安全性的軍事網(wǎng)絡(luò)和較小的商業(yè)網(wǎng)絡(luò)。
? 路由更新慢,不適用大型網(wǎng)絡(luò)。
2.動態(tài)路由算法(自適應(yīng)路由算法)
? 特點 :路由器間彼此交換信息,按照路由算法優(yōu)化出路由表項。
? 路由更新快,適用大型網(wǎng)絡(luò),及時響應(yīng)鏈路費用或網(wǎng)絡(luò)拓撲變化。
? 算法復(fù)雜,增加網(wǎng)絡(luò)負擔(dān)。
? 分類:
- 全局性(鏈路狀態(tài)算法)OSPF
? 所有路由器掌握完整的網(wǎng)絡(luò)拓撲和鏈路費用信息。
- 分散性 (距離向量路由算法)RIP
? 路由器只掌握物理相連的鄰居及鏈路費用。
自治系統(tǒng)AS:在單一的技術(shù)管理下的一組路由器,而這些路由器使用一種AS內(nèi)部的路由選擇協(xié)議和共同的度量 以確定分組在該AS內(nèi)的路由,同時還使用一種AS 之間的路由協(xié)議以確定AS之間的路由。
一個AS內(nèi)的所有網(wǎng)絡(luò)都屬于一個行政單位來管轄,一個自治系統(tǒng)的所有路由器在本自治系統(tǒng)內(nèi)都必須連通
路由選擇協(xié)議
1.內(nèi)部網(wǎng)關(guān)協(xié)議IGP (一個AS內(nèi)使用的RIP、OSPF)
RIP協(xié)議
RIP是一種分布式的基于距離向量的路由選擇協(xié)議,要求網(wǎng)絡(luò)中的每一個路由器都維護從他自己到其他每一個目的網(wǎng)絡(luò)的唯一的最佳距離記錄。RIP允許一條路由最多包含15個路由器,因此距離為16表示網(wǎng)絡(luò)不可達。
適用于小互聯(lián)網(wǎng)。
僅和路由器交換信息,交換的是自己的路由表,每30秒交換一次路由信息。
距離向量算法
1.修改相鄰路由器發(fā)來的RIP報文中所有表項
對于地址為x的相鄰路由器發(fā)來的RIP報文:把“下一跳”字段中的地址改為x,并把所有的距離字段+1
2.對修改后的RIP報文中的每一個項目。進行一下步驟:
(1)R1路由表中若沒有Net3,則把該項目填入R1路由表
(2)R1路由表中若有Net3,則查看下一跳路由器地址:
? 若下一跳是x,則用收到的項目替換源路由表中的項目;
? 若下一跳不是x,原來距離比從x走的距離遠則更新,否則不作處理。
3.若180s還沒有收到相鄰路由器x的更新路由表,則把x記為不可達的路由器,即把距離設(shè)置為16。
OSPF協(xié)議
開放最短路徑優(yōu)先OSPF協(xié)議使用分布式的鏈路狀態(tài)協(xié)議
1.使用洪泛法向自治系統(tǒng)內(nèi)所有路由器發(fā)送信息
2.發(fā)送的信息就是與本路由器相鄰的所有路由器的鏈路狀態(tài)
3.只有當(dāng)鏈路狀態(tài)發(fā)生變化時,路由器才向所有路由器洪泛發(fā)送此信息。
適用于大互聯(lián)網(wǎng),收斂速度很快。
2.外部網(wǎng)關(guān)協(xié)議EGP (AS之間使用的BGP)
BGP協(xié)議
1.與其他AS的鄰站BGP發(fā)言人交換信息。
2.交換的網(wǎng)絡(luò)可達性的信息,即要到達某個網(wǎng)絡(luò)所要經(jīng)過的一系列AS。
3.發(fā)生變化時更新有變化的部分。
三種路由協(xié)議比較

浙公網(wǎng)安備 33010602011771號